Anyone read Brendan Brazier's new book yet? I would recomend it to anyone looking for more information on the Vegan lifestyle from an athletic view. The book has a lot of good recipes for anything from energy jels or sports drinks to regular meals. While I enjoyed reading ETL I think the Thrive books has information in to give me that extra edge I thought I needed as someone who works out six days a week. :)
 
I forgot to say the book I am talking about it called "The Thrive Diet". It is not really a diet though just a whole food appoach to training.
 
I recently ordered "The Thrive Diet" from Amazon.ca (since the 'regular' Amazon.com didn't have it listed yet). I really enjoyed the original "Thrive": it influenced me to change my diet for the better by adding some foods like hemp, maca and chlorella. It was also obviously written by an intelligent person, which I appreciate when I read anything, health-related or not.
